TriChrome consists of {Library, Chrome, WebView}. Each of these units can be an input to SuperSize. To get SuperSize to aggregate these into one .size file with a common pool of symbols, we'd like to to abstract these units as "containers", represented by the Container class, which relates to other data structure by the following: * A SizeInfo has 1 or more Containers. * A Container consists of {metadata, section_sizes} (formerly in SizeInfo), and has a distinct name. * Each Symbol belongs to a Container. This CL adds the Container class to SuperSize, and rewire former usage of {metadata, section_sizes} to go through it. Only the *single* Container case (with name='') is handled, to simplify review and commits. The format of .size files is kept invariant. And as seen in .golden file, very few changes to SuperSize-console output. A number of TODOs are added to indicate upcoming code changes for multi-Container support. Other changes: * describe.py: Use itertools.chain.from_iterable() so that chained generators can be appended into array, instead of needing distinct local variables. * diff.py: Add _DiffObj() to generalize diffing. The CL is fixing the issue where the IO-Thread was not receiving the power manager notifications. The observer list doesn't register observers without a sequence being set. void AddObserver(ObserverType* observer) { // TODO(fdoray): Change this to a DCHECK once all call sites have a // SequencedTaskRunnerHandle. if (!SequencedTaskRunnerHandle::IsSet()) return; Previously, these observers were not registered and notifications were not received. Currently, the thread controller bind to the current thread but has conditional code depending if the task runner is set. see: ThreadControllerWithMessagePumpImpl::BindToCurrentThread if (task_runner_) InitializeThreadTaskRunnerHandle(); The function InitializeThreadTaskRunnerHandle(...) is the place to make the link between the PowerMonitor and the Controller since a task_runner is required for power notifications. Alex Moshchuk authored
This CL follows up on the session history changes in https://chromium-review.googlesource.com/c/chromium/src/+/2181973. Prior to that CL, inactive frames or frames with no FrameNavigationEntry returned early from FindFramesToNavigate(), without recursing down into subframes. After that CL, we will now recurse into subframes and keep looking for navigations in those cases. This is harmless, since an inactive frame's children should all be inactive as well, and subframes of a frame with no FNE also won't have FNEs, but it's also redundant. This CL modifies the new flow through DetermineActionForHistoryNavigation() to match the old behavior and stop looking for navigations in subframes in those cases. Dominic Mazzoni authored
Previously, in order to do a hit test for accessibility we'd send an action to the renderer with the x,y coordinates, and the renderer would fire an accessibility event on the matching node. It'd be more flexible if we had an API that could do a hit test and call a callback function with the result. That eliminates the need for keeping track of requests and matching them up with events. This patch refactors the way hit testing works so that a hit testing request may contain a request for an accessibility event to fire, or a callback function to call, or both. Existing tests are extended to cover both mechanisms. Victor Fei authored
The motivation behind this change is that for content like below, Windows Narrator cannot trigger the links in the tabs. <div role="tablist"> <a href="https://twitter.com" role="tab">tab1</a> <a href="https://wikipedia.org" role="tab">tab2</a> <a href="https://w3.org" role="tab">tab3</a> </div> This is because for single-selection container we have the behavior that selection follows focus. https://www.w3.org/TR/wai-aria-practices-1.1/#kbd_selection_follows_focus In Item Navigation, Narrator sets focus first to the tab, but upon focus the a11y selected state is set to true. When Narrator attempts to perform ISelectionItemProvider::Select (Enter) on the tab to trigger the link, no action would occur because the selected state is already set to true. This CL fixes UIA::ISelectionItemProvider::Select() to still perform action::kDoDefault if the element is already selected due to focus. Previously, if an element is already selected, for any reason, Select() would not perform any a11y action. This CL also introduces ax::mojom::BoolAttribute::kSelectedFromFocus and uses it to communicate between renderer process and browser process that an element is selected due to it being focused. This CL should not affect ISelectionItemProvider::Select() behavior on multiselectable containers. AX-Relnotes: Windows Narrator can now trigger default action on an element in a single-selection container such as a tabitem.
